Awards

The Sunshine Coast Street Angels have been extensively recognised for the professional management of volunteers, best practice methods of operation, innovation and positive impact on the community:

  • A State and Regional winner at the Queensland Premier’s International Year of Volunteers 2001 State awards.
  • Recipient of the National Australia Bank Community Link Queensland State Award 2000 and 2002 (Community Services Category) recognising excellence in Volunteer Program Coordination.
  • Receipt of the Benjamin Award, 2000, (Queensland Health) in conjunction with other key stakeholders of the Mooloolaba Streetsafe Program, which recognises excellence in drug and alcohol intervention programs.
  • Shay Zulpo, the inaugural Manager and past Board Member of Community Solutions Inc, was awarded an Australia Day Medal in 2001, by the Alcohol and other Drugs Council of Australia. Shay was the recipient of one of only 5 Australia Day Medals awarded nationally, to unsung heroes working in the alcohol and other drugs sector. In addition, Shay was recognised in the 2001 Australia Day Awards in the Fisher electorate for her commitment to community service.
